trauma training manikins have become an essential tool in the field of medical education. These highly advanced simulators are designed to mimic human anatomy and exhibit physiological responses to trauma in a realistic manner. Medical professionals and students can use these manikins to practice a wide range of skills, from basic first aid to complex emergency procedures. In this article, we will explore the importance of trauma training manikins in medical education and the benefits they offer to those in the healthcare field.
One of the key benefits of trauma training manikins is their ability to provide hands-on experience in a controlled environment. Medical students can practice various medical procedures on these manikins without the risk of harming a real patient. This hands-on experience allows students to develop their skills and confidence before working with real patients, ultimately improving patient outcomes and safety. Additionally, the realistic nature of these manikins helps to create a sense of urgency and pressure that closely resembles real-life medical emergencies, preparing students for high-stress situations in a safe setting.
trauma training manikins also offer a wide range of training scenarios that can be customized to meet the specific needs of different medical specialties. Whether it’s simulating a car accident victim with multiple injuries or a patient in cardiac arrest, these manikins can be programmed to exhibit various symptoms and responses to treatment. This versatility allows medical professionals to practice a diverse range of skills and scenarios, ensuring that they are well-prepared to handle any situation they may encounter in their practice.
In addition to providing realistic training scenarios, trauma training manikins can also provide immediate feedback to the user. These manikins are equipped with sensors that can track the user’s performance during a simulation, providing valuable data on the effectiveness of their interventions. This feedback can help students identify areas for improvement and refine their skills, ultimately leading to better patient care. By analyzing this data, instructors can also assess the overall proficiency of their students and tailor their training programs to address any deficiencies.
Furthermore, trauma training manikins can help bridge the gap between theoretical knowledge and practical skills. While textbooks and lectures are essential components of medical education, hands-on practice is crucial for developing proficiency in medical procedures. trauma training manikins allow students to apply their knowledge in a realistic setting, reinforcing their understanding of complex medical concepts and enhancing their problem-solving skills. This practical experience can help students retain information more effectively and apply it confidently in real-world situations.
Another significant benefit of trauma training manikins is their ability to simulate rare or high-risk medical scenarios that students may not encounter frequently in clinical practice. By exposing students to these scenarios in a safe and controlled environment, manikins can help them develop the necessary skills and confidence to handle these situations effectively. This exposure can be especially valuable for preparing medical professionals for emergencies that require quick thinking and decisive action, such as mass casualty incidents or natural disasters.
